PURPOSE:

This position supports overall global inventory management including forecasting, demand planning, data analysis, data integrity, and related process improvement. The SCA creates and maintains demand plans, incorporating business intelligence and forecast information gathered from historical data and statistical analysis, along with input from the Executive Team and appropriate business partners from the Commercial and Global Supply Teams. They then manage the output of that demand plan and related systems parameters in order to optimize the local/country/global inventory position over time, while providing excellent customer service.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ES (performs other duties as assigned):

    • Enables achievement of overall business and supply chain goals via activities that create reliable demand plans, constantly improving forecast to achieve forecast accuracy goals.
    • Performs advanced data analysis and creates reporting as needed to support processes of the Demand Planning & Analytics team and Global Supply as a whole. Develops and maintains KPI dashboards, maintains global/local core status, etc.
    • Leads collaborative forecast and inventory planning meetings (S&OP) with business partners to generate consensus demand forecasts.
    • Proposes and maintains adjustments to forecast and inventory targets based on changes in demand and market trends. Tracks and measures the accuracy of those adjustments.
    • Optimizes inventory levels by calculating and maintaining planning parameters, making efficient sourcing decisions, and supporting accurate sourcing rules for mill-direct replenishment.
    • Supports creation and revision of internal material specifications, bills of material and routings.
    • Maintains a high level of data integrity utilizing DI inconsistency reports.
    • Leads/supports cross-functional projects related to continuous improvement of productivity, inventory turns, lead times, service levels, profitability, and/or revenue growth.
    • Supports effective execution of all related software and systems as appropriate. Recommends and implements enhancements to systems supporting forecasting, demand planning, and inventory management.
    • Provides input to the Supply Chain team in developing inventory strategies on existing items, new products, and product phase-outs. Measures and manages the performance of those strategies.
    • Provides administrative support for supply chain activities, including maintaining records, coordinating information, preparing documentation, and supporting departmental initiatives as required.

    Company Overview: Founded in 1890, A. M. Castle & Co. is a global distributor of specialty metal and plastic products and supply chain services, principally serving the producer durable equipment, oil and gas, commercial aircraft, heavy equipment, industrial goods, construction equipment, retail, marine and automotive sectors of the global economy. Its customer base includes many Fortune 500 companies as well as thousands of medium and smaller-sized firms spread across a variety of industries. Within its metals business, it specializes in the distribution of alloy and stainless steels; nickel alloys; aluminum and carbon. Together, Castle operates service centers located throughout North America, Europe and Asia.
